Whanganui police seek help from public after assault in Bennett St

A 28-year-old man was treated and discharged from Whanganui Hospital after an assault at a house in Bennett St, Tawhero.

Senior Sergeant Shayne Wainhouse said Whanganui police were keen to hear from anyone who was in the area about 10pm on Saturday, February 24.

"Three males turned up at an address in Bennett St, have gone to the front door and assaulted a 28-year-old male at the property," Mr Wainhouse said.

"They left in a white BMW car. We are interested in hearing from anyone in the area at the time who may have seen the three males or the vehicle leaving the area."

The three males are described as in their 20s but there was no other description.

Anyone with information should contact Detective Paul Heathcote on 349 0600.
